Tilt Five: Holographic Tabletop Gaming is now on Kickstarter and it looks amazing. The fact that they are partnered with Fantasy Grounds is also awesome...
Imagine D&D as a table top game you all sit and play around with your own view of the table, digital character sheets, truly hidden NPC and player movement, and the ability to roll dice on the board and automatically pass along the result (so your bad at math players don't get frustrated), throw down D&D spell cards and select targets to get a visual on the area of effect. Move physical minis on a never ending scrolling map. Never need to look for the next tile or map. Then you just clean up by folding the board and dropping it and the googles into a bag and walking out.
